Frost Opera Theater presents Ralph Vaughan Williams’ haunting one-act opera Riders to the Sea, a poignant meditation on loss, resilience, and the enduring power of the sea. Set against the stark beauty of the Aran Islands, the opera tells the story of Maurya, a mother who has lost nearly all the men in her family to the ocean’s unforgiving force. With its deeply expressive score and intimate storytelling, Riders to the Sea offers audiences a moving exploration of grief and acceptance, brought to life by the exceptional artistry of Frost’s rising performers.

Music Director Jenny Snyder@snidejenny leads the production, with Linus Ip conducting and Ellie Lee .lucette_ at the piano, under the program direction of Jeffrey Buchman.

A special aspect of this production is that our Frost Opera students directed the show under the guidance of Professor Buchman. This production will be presented twice. The performance on the 22nd is directed by Frost Opera students Caitlin Turner (M.M.) and Julia Woodring (D.M.A.) .woodring
Each performance offers a unique interpretive perspective on Vaughan Williams’s evocative work, making this a special opportunity to experience the opera in two distinct stagings.
